TW3 in the United Kingdom offers a practical, family-friendly suburb feel with well-connected transport links, a mix of traditional and modern homes, and green spaces that balance convenience with a calmer pace of life.

When considering TW3, assess proximity to your preferred train lines and future development plans that could affect property values. Compare commute times to central London and check local school catchment areas if you have children. For investors, evaluate rental yield versus purchase price and look for properties with good outdoor space or parking to maximize appeal.
